Usage of multicriteria decision‐making support arsenal for strategic planning in environmental protection sphere

Abstract: This paper outlines an approach to strategic planning, based on decision‐making support methods. It provides a description of a step‐by‐step procedure, allowing the decision maker to build a strategy, targeted at solution of some weakly structured problem or at achievement of some complex goal, influenced by multiple tangible and intangible criteria. Criteria are formulated by experts and arranged into a hierarchy, as prescribed by the analytic hierarchy process. Relative weights of criteria are calculated on … Show more
